A Mexican Late Classic Saltillo sarape Circa 1840-1860 Woven in wool in two panels seamed down the middle, with multicolored vertical serrated columns and a concentric-style diamond to center, with narrow meandering and curvilinear border motifs 82.5" H x 53" W approximately With dust accumulation and wear commensurate with age and use. Scattered small holes and areas of stitch loss overall, the largest: 4.5" L, with multiple areas of stitched repair and weave reinforcement to center and to edges. Small sections of ravelling to some edges, with attendant stitch losses. Scattered small areas of dye transfer.
